Government Nasha Mukti Kendra is a rehabilitation center established and operated by governmental authorities or agencies. These centers are typically part of the government's efforts to address the issue of substance abuse and addiction within the community. Government Nasha Mukti Kendras may offer a range of services including medical treatment, counseling, rehabilitation programs, vocational training, and social reintegration support. They often follow standardized protocols and guidelines set by the government to ensure quality care and adherence to legal and ethical standards.
